When I say caramel, you probably think of the ooey, gooey, super sweet caramel that is found in commercial candy.  Now imagine something much better.  A rich, dark caramel that is silky smooth and melts in your mouth.  A caramel that is made from scratch using all natural ingredients, just the way you would make it (if you knew how and had the time!).  This is the signature milk caramel of Caramel Swirls, a gourmet cake and pastry shop located in Daytona Beach, FL.

Caramel Swirls is an all natural bakery that whips up irresistible desserts from scratch each day.  I recently had the pleasure of working with Caramel Swirls for a baby shower I hosted.  They provided some of their decadent goodies for the dessert table along with extra samples for us to try.  Let me tell you, everyone was raving!  I wish you could lick your screen to get a taste, but you’ll have to rely on my descriptive vocabulary for now.  So grab your coffee and prepare to drool as we take a look at the sweet treats of Caramel Swirls.
Caramel Swirls Gourmet Cakes & Pastries

These Cafe Caramel Cookies are the perfect combination of chocolate, coffee and caramel. Two thin espresso infused chocolate shortbread cookies filled with milk caramel filling then dipped in chocolate.  Both beautiful and delicious!

Caramel Swirls Gourmet Cakes & Pastries

My personal favorite had to be the caramel Little Treasures.  Is it candy?  Is it a cookie?  Is it a petit four?  These little treats are hard to label and even harder to resist.  Once you’re past the smooth chocolate exterior you’ll find a dollop of rich milk caramel on top of a vanilla shortbread cookie.  This little gem is so unique and quite honestly one of the best treats I’ve tasted.  Period.

Also noteworthy were the Espresso Brownies and Mudslide Orange Walnut Cookies.  The brownies were crisp and flaky on the outside but dense, rich and moist on the inside.  Just as a brownie should be!  I personally did not try any of the Mudslide Cookies (only because I ate too many Little Treasures!) but everyone else loved them.  How could a cookie that combines chocolate chips, orange zest, espresso and toasted walnuts be anything less than amazing?
Caramel Swirls Gourmet Cakes & Pastries

Last but certainly not least are the Winter White Caramel Cookies.  This was another favorite!  A light and crisp meringue coating surrounds two honey cookies filled with milk caramel.  It’s a cookie… but it’s also like a little miniature cake.  It’s moist, filled with caramel and just plain good.

If you haven’t figured it out by now, I’ve become a huge fan of Caramel Swirls.  Everything arrived on time, beautifully packaged and tasting scrumptious.  These treats would be a perfect gift for Mother’s Day, birthdays or any day.  And you can feel good about your order knowing that these sweet creations are not only delicious but have a mission: to help fight childhood hunger. For every cake you purchase Caramel Swirls will donate 10% of the sales price to help feed a child in need.   Now that is a double treat!

I was very excited to see this adorable display sent in by Stephanie of Spaceships and Laser Beams featuring their Snakes & Snails Collection.  Not only is this party collection completely cute but the display is a nice twist on the typical dessert table.  This Snakes & Snails Brunch Buffet would make the perfect first birthday party!
Snakes & Snails Dessert Table

Here is some of what Stephanie had to share with us:

“We only sell boys supplies and I get so many comments about people not thinking that boys parties can be as beautiful as girls parties. We wanted to do something to show that this isn’t the case. In addition, the Snakes and Snails theme is for the younger set.”

Snakes & Snails Dessert Table

Snakes & Snails Dessert Table

More of what Stephanie had to share with us:

“We thought it would be good to show how you could have a sweets table for the brunch-time party first birthday party.  Typically, there are more adults than kids at first birthdays so we thought it would be a great option.  The birthday details could also be easily swapped out for a baby shower.”
Snakes & Snails Dessert Table

I don’t know about you, but I definitely think they achieved their goal – this party display is just beautiful and still completely appropriate for a little man.  I love the concept of a brunch buffet, providing more than just sweets.  The green apples are perfect… they are decorative and a healthy food choice all in one!
